Defense Program Senior ManagerKey Role:
Assume responsibility for driving performance across the USINDOPACOM lines of business, refreshing the Indo-Pacific joint contract portfolio, and driving focused growth campaigns across the business lines. Apply expertise as a results-oriented, innovative business leader with a background in modern digital technology and analytics, primarily bringing new capabilities, applications, and services to the market and developing new business. Design, implement, and maintain organizational programs in support of corporate strategy. Assume responsibility for managing large contracts, providing leadership for business development activities, and developing future leaders. Maintain accountability for the quality and efficiency of programs, including technical issues, delivery, and businesses processes. Communicate and coordinate regularly and proactively with senior government clients and company leadership on potential contractual, programmatic, or resource limitation issues.
